[{{mminutes}}:{{sseconds}}] X
Пользователь приглашает вас присоединиться к открытой игре игре с друзьями .
Ctrl предыдущая следующая Ctrl Страницы
1 ... 34 35 36 37 38 39 40 41 42 43 44 45 46 ... 60

Форум «Программное обеспечение» / KlavoTools: Chromium & Firefox

Fenex Сообщение #803 18 февраля 2015 в 15:52
Клавомеханик
49
Phemmer, я исправил ошибку в коде, которая приводила к ошибке в консоли. А ещё оказывается автор скрипта должен продлить свой домен (http://manoq.com/googletr.php?text=сообщение)
Последний раз отредактировано 18 февраля 2015 в 15:53 модератором Fenex
turbulent Сообщение #804 18 февраля 2015 в 16:08
Кибергонщик
45
постоянно перестают работать Клавотулс в Хроме. Поработает минут 10 и все, приходится закрывать браузер и заходить по новому.
Phemmer Сообщение #805 18 февраля 2015 в 20:27
Супермен
71
Часто не срабатывает KG_ChatHotkey, если обновить страницу - сработает. Хотя установленный до этого через tampermonkey отлично работал.
в консоли вот это:
скрытый текст…

upd: не только KG_ChatHotkey не срабатывает но и как ранее упомянутый KG_CenterAlignment не всегда показывает шестененку, так и вылет от нажатия бекспейся теперь срабатывает не во 100% случаях. в старом же клавотулсе работало в 100% случаев.
И еще Журнал заездов не всегда срабатывает, это наглядно видно, если его просматривать


И еще, скорее хотелка, в скрипте hide_cars сделать третье состояние: скрывать машины когда их много (>10 например)
Последний раз отредактировано 1 марта 2015 в 11:34 пользователем Phemmer
Potatore Сообщение #806 18 февраля 2015 в 21:04
Супермен
57
Поставил дополнение для ФФ ) Все красиво, только теперь ТС показывает одно, а сайт - плюс-минус 30-40 знаков, причем в разные стороны. Удалил, короче )
Или это сайт глючит.. После удаления резалты глючные не прекратились )
Последний раз отредактировано 18 февраля 2015 в 21:39 пользователем Potatore
Mellow Сообщение #807 18 февраля 2015 в 22:40
Кибергонщик
30
Добавьте пожалуйста этот скрипт в КлавоТулс:

http://userscripts-mirror.org/scripts/show/176574
Phemmer Сообщение #808 19 февраля 2015 в 14:53
Супермен
71
Если в настройках отключить уведомления об иксах в выпадающем списке, то после перезапуска хрома там снова появится 1 минута.

Исправлено --Fenex
Последний раз отредактировано 27 марта 2015 в 05:33 модератором Fenex
Phemmer Сообщение #809 19 февраля 2015 в 16:15
Супермен
71
Похоже починили баг со всплывающей подсказкой в статистике и одновременно с этим опять сломалось StatisticsAvgResults
Lakira Сообщение #810 19 февраля 2015 в 20:07
Супермен
56
Ура! KlavoTools в Firefox!

Мелочь: процент ошибок наползает на ник (вроде бы это от скрипта, добавляющего сотые к скорости?):
скрытый текст…


UPD:
При нажатии на кнопку KlavoTools нет ссылки на непрочитанное сообщение.
скрытый текст…

Последний раз отредактировано 19 февраля 2015 в 20:55 пользователем Lakira
AstonMartinDB10 Сообщение #811 19 февраля 2015 в 20:08
Экстракибер
42
FF: Не работает скрипт добавления заезда в бортжурнал.

Исправлено --Fenex
Последний раз отредактировано 27 марта 2015 в 05:33 модератором Fenex
Phemmer Сообщение #812 21 февраля 2015 в 21:00
Супермен
71
Неплохо бы еще и вернуть/доработать контекстные меню на словарях и пользователях.

И скрипты, работающие в профиле тоже не всегда срабатывают, например KG_InfiniteScroll и другие, хотя через tampermonkey они же срабатывали всегда.
ТОМА-АТОМНАЯ Сообщение #813 3 марта 2015 в 14:33
Организатор событий
116
Скажите, а как можно узнать, чтобы КТС был с тем же функционалом в доработанном виде, что и в мозилле. Мне понравилось, там скрипт выдачи очков работает лучше, чем в хроме, да и диалоговое окно очень нравится.
Заранее большое спс за КТС в мозилле.
chikaldirick Сообщение #814 22 марта 2015 в 17:44
Экстракибер
19
//Мимо крокодил
Ссылки на userscripts и KlavoTools для Сафари сломались
Последний раз отредактировано 22 марта 2015 в 17:47 пользователем chikaldirick
Potatore Сообщение #815 24 марта 2015 в 16:47
Супермен
57
https://github.com/voidmain02/KgScripts
Кажется, их там теперь не будет, все на гитхабе
Fenex Сообщение #816 27 марта 2015 в 07:45
Клавомеханик
49
Версия 3.1.0: Chromium | Firefox

Изменения:
- Не работает скрипт добавления заезда в бортжурнал. (исправлено, плюс попутно найден баг в самом скрипте - в пользовательских словарях скрипт не работал вообще)
- Если в настройках отключить уведомления об иксах в выпадающем списке, то после перезапуска хрома там снова появится 1 минута. (исправлено)
- В прежнем клавотулс цветовой стиль сайта применялся на страницах быстрее, а теперь сначала прорисовывается стандартный бежевый, потом меняется на заданный в настройках. (сделано кэширование)
- Пропало из значка на верхней панели клавотулс меню “ссылки” - было очень удобно пользоваться добавленными туда ссылками (добавлено)
- Находясь на странице настроек клавотулс ссылка вверху справа “Словари” не рабочая (исправлено)


Продолжаем тестить. Особенно интересует:
1) Насколько лучше стало с цветовым оформлением в плане быстроты применения;
2) баг, описанный в сообщении#805 и #812 (второй абзац).
agile Сообщение #817 27 марта 2015 в 08:31
Новичок
37
Fenex писал(а):
Идея в том, что все скрипты равны между собой, и они не хранятся в расширении, а подтягиваются из репозитория. Вначале вообще неизвестно какие скрипты там есть. Я тут вижу два выхода из ситуации (что из этого лучше - непонятно):
1. Создать дополнительный файл в репозитории, в котором всё это прописать;
2. Добавить в метаданные к каждому userjs дополнительную информацию:


Включать все скрипты из репозитория чревато — могут возникнуть конфликты (KG_ClearProfile и KG_GlasslessBio, если последний сейчас замержим).

Предлагаю поступить по пункту 2 (разграничить скрипты, производящие глобальные изменения, и те, что добавляют небольшие фичи), но добавить также что-то вроде тегов:

  1. Игра
  2. Рейтинговое соревнование
  3. Форум
  4. Словари
  5. Сводка профиля
  6. Статистика
  7. ...

— это позволит оформить в более удобном виде список всех скриптов в репозитории, да и в настройках KTS можно будет ввести фильтрацию по этим тегам.
Phemmer Сообщение #818 27 марта 2015 в 11:22
Супермен
71
Шестеренка в KG_CenterAlignment часто не появляется (и весь блок настроек отсутствует) если в заезд перейти следующий образом: вставить url в адресную строку и нажать enter.
С KG_ChatHotkey проблема не срабатывания тоже осталась. (в консоли ошибок при этом то же, что и когда он срабатывает)

С применением цветовой схемы, попробовал на разных страницах и разными способами перехода - все еще очень часто не сразу применяется (в отличие от старого клавотулс), самый "плохой способ" это опять таки, вставить url в адресную строку и нажать enter, но не только так.

В профиле тоже. Из тех что сразу заметно, часто не появляются KG_TotalGamesCount, KG_GameLog, klavostats_links, настройка KG_ChatHotkey.

А защиты от вылета по бекспейс и вовсе нет, я так понял, она не вошла в состав. Хорошо бы возвратить.

Это все во хроме.
Fenex Сообщение #819 27 марта 2015 в 11:50
Клавомеханик
49
agile писал(а):
Включать все скрипты из репозитория чревато — могут возникнуть конфликты (KG_ClearProfile и KG_GlasslessBio, если последний сейчас замержим).

Да, это проблема.

Я уже описывал ранее два способа решения таких проблем. Либо создавать в репозитории json-файл, где прописывать все настройки для всех скриптов, либо в каждом скрипте в блоке метаданных добавлять свои поля. Возможно есть ещё какие-нибудь варианты...
Но что-то надо точно делать, вот только как будет лучше - это вопрос.
Последний раз отредактировано 27 марта 2015 в 11:51 модератором Fenex
ТОМА-АТОМНАЯ Сообщение #820 27 марта 2015 в 13:12
Организатор событий
116
agile писал(а):
Включать все скрипты из репозитория чревато — могут возникнуть конфликты (KG_ClearProfile и KG_GlasslessBio, если последний сейчас замержим).

Предлагаю поступить по пункту 2 (разграничить скрипты, производящие глобальные изменения, и те, что добавляют небольшие фичи), но добавить также что-то вроде тегов:

  1. Игра
  2. Рейтинговое соревнование
  3. Форум
  4. Словари
  5. Сводка профиля
  6. Статистика
  7. ...

— это позволит оформить в более удобном виде список всех скриптов в репозитории, да и в настройках KTS можно будет ввести фильтрацию по этим тегам.


Написано сложно, но суть в том, что можно бы сделать не все скрипты по умолчанию, идею поддерживаю. Ибо с великой радости, что в мозилле доступна КТС и облегчит задачу раздачи очков, создала заезд с марафона, вижу списка друзей нет, началась паника, пришлось просить всех случайно зашедших срочно звать всех друзей, ко второму заезду сообразила, что не браузер виноват, а новая КТС, отключила ее, провела без приключений. Спасибо Феммеру, сказал, какой именно скрипт надо в КТС на мозилле отключить (№7), чтобы ею пользоваться по тем параметрам, ради которых устанавливала. Галочки должны быть на глобальных вещах, типа сортировки, а уж по центру расширять сайт и жертвовать списком друзей - это все же частность, она другим не нужна и таких мелочей много. К тому же у каждого скрипта в табличке настроек есть пояснение, что это такое и какую функцию выполняет, каждый вполне может настроить, как ему удобнее.
Тема поднимается не так часто, посмотреть что с чем конфликтует можно и здесь в теме, выбрать галочкой что-то одно, более нужное для себя из конфликтующих.
Последний раз отредактировано 27 марта 2015 в 18:47 пользователем ТОМА-АТОМНАЯ
agile Сообщение #821 27 марта 2015 в 13:25
Новичок
37
Fenex писал(а):
Я уже описывал ранее два способа решения таких проблем. Либо создавать в репозитории json-файл, где прописывать все настройки для всех скриптов, либо в каждом скрипте в блоке метаданных добавлять свои поля.


На мой взгляд, оба способа одинаково хороши. Как насчет такой структуры json?

{
    "KG_ChatHotkey": {
        "tags": [ "Чат", "Игра" ]
    },
    "KG_ClearProfile": {
        "global": true,
        "tags": [ "Сводка профиля" ],
        "conflicts": [ "KG_GlasslessBio" ]
    },
    "KG_CenterAlignment": {
        "global": true,
        "tags": [ "Игра" ]
    },
    "KG_GlasslessBio": {
        "global": true,
        "tags": [ "Сводка профиля" ],
        "conflicts": [ "KG_ClearProfile" ]
    },
    ...
}


— поле global определяет масштаб вносимых скриптом изменений, tags — теги для классификации (может, пригодится), conflicts — конфликтующие скрипты.

ТОМА-АТОМНАЯ писал(а):
Галочки должны быть на глобальных вещах, типа сортировки, а уж по центру расширять сайт и жертвовать списком друзей - это все же частность, она другим не нужна и таких мелочей много.

Скорее, галочки должны стоять для тех скриптов, которые не вносят каких-то глобальных изменений в текущий дизайн (расположение существующих элементов, их поведение), а лишь добавляют новое :)
Последний раз отредактировано 27 марта 2015 в 13:39 пользователем agile
Fenex Сообщение #822 27 марта 2015 в 13:39
Клавомеханик
49
Тэги определённо нужны, полезная вещь. Можно сделать нечтоподобное, как в техцентре.
Надо будет создать обсуждение структуры конфига на гитхабе. В klavotools-kango или KgScripts. Большинству тут это не интересно, да и нам там удобнее будет.

Чтобы писать в форуме, нужно зарегистрироваться.

Ctrl предыдущая следующая Ctrl Страницы
1 ... 34 35 36 37 38 39 40 41 42 43 44 45 46 ... 60

Связаться
Выделить
Выделите фрагменты страницы, относящиеся к вашему сообщению
Скрыть сведения
Скрыть всю личную информацию
Отмена